Her extensive experience in the world of fine wine spans over twenty years, including active leadership roles at three internationally recognized South African wineries. She was also the founding member of Hamilton Russell Oregon.

Raised on a cattle ranch near the Swaziland border in South Africa – a property that had been in her family for nearly 200 years – Olive’s connection to the land runs deep. When she and her sister had to make the heartbreaking decision to sell their farm, Olive chose to honor her heritage by investing her share of the proceeds in a personal wine venture.

At the time, she was deeply involved in her then-husband’s family wineries, with the US market as one of her responsibilities. Her love for Pinot Noir and Chardonnay and the US inspired her quest to express these varietals through terroirs different from then her home soil. After initially exploring California’s famed Pinot Noir regions, Olive attended her first International Pinot Noir Celebration (IPNC) in Oregon in 2015. That weekend, she fell in love with the combination of opulent fruit purity and restrained elegance she had never encountered in any new world Pinot Noir producing region. She committed herself to finding a way to make wine in the Willamette Valley.

Equipped with the knowledge gained during almost two decades of a deep involvement in the production and marketing of internationally respected South African Pinot Noir and Chardonnay, the inaugural vintage of Hamilton Russell Oregon Pinot Noir was vinified in 2018.

The maiden vintage of OLIVE HAMILTON RUSSELL, the 2023, is the first vintage with Olive as sole winemaker. She now lives in the Willamette Valley and is responsible for every aspect of the business – vineyard partnerships to winemaking, management to marketing. She has secured long-term relationships with LIVE Certified growers across the Valley and makes her wines at the Northwest Wine Company in Dundee. Olive holds the WSET Diploma and continues her winemaking studies through short courses at UC Davis. She is grateful to learn and benefit from the guidance of the expert team at the winery.

Before establishing her own label, Olive spent nearly two decades working within her former husband’s family wineries in South Africa, building their international reach, respect and success. This extensive experience shaped her commitment to terroir-driven, small-lot winemaking and provided a deep understanding of the discipline and nuance required to produce world-class wines.

Olive studied Food Science and Nutrition at the University of Stellenbosch and holds both the WSET Diploma and the Cape Wine Academy Diploma. She is the author of the award-winning cookbook Entertaining at Hamilton Russell Vineyards, a Gourmand Award recipient, and has appeared on numerous food and wine television programs.

She has served on international food and wine judging panels and participated in wine seminars across Oregon, Florida, Massachusetts, and California. She currently serves on the board of the Eola-Amity Hills Winegrowers Association.
